Skinker DeBaliviere, St. Louis, MO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ent a home in Skinker DeBaliviere?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Skinker DeBaliviere 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,716 | $895 | $3,800 |
| Skinker DeBaliviere 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,913 | $495 | $3,250 |
| Skinker DeBaliviere 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,132 | $1,795 | $3,995 |
| Skinker DeBaliviere 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,872 | $2,872 | $2,872 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Skinker DeBaliviere
What type of rentals are currently available in Skinker DeBaliviere?
There are currently 600 Apartments for Rent in Skinker DeBaliviere, MO with pricing that ranges from $550 to $7,953. There are also 114 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Skinker DeBaliviere ranging from $400 to $3,995.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Skinker DeBaliviere?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Skinker DeBaliviere ranges from $400 to $3,995 with an average monthly rent of $1,886.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Skinker DeBaliviere?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Skinker DeBaliviere range from $687 to $5,303,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$495 to $3,250.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,795 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$893.
